Researchers uncover keys to safer anesthesia for leg surgery

NCT ID NCT07581561

First seen Jun 27, 2026 · Last updated Jun 27, 2026

Summary

This study observed 318 adults having leg surgery to find out what factors help make spinal anesthesia work on only the operated side. The goal is to reduce side effects like low blood pressure. Researchers looked at patient age, weight, position, and injection technique to improve success rates.
